About This Item
Hutchinson, 1994. 1st Edition . Hardcover. Near Fine. First Edition. Near Fine hardcover with marbled boards. This copy is numbered 108/150 limited copies signed by the author Kingsley Amis. FFEP is inscribed by previous owner, author John Metcalf. Gold titling to spine. Clear acetate jacket. A top copy!

About Biblioasis
Biblioasis Bookshop is a small independent bookshop, located in the heart of Old Walkerville in Windsor, Ontario. We have a carefully curated collection of new and used books, from classics, to the obscure and esoteric! We specialize in Canadian literature, first editions, signed books, the eighteenth century, and books about books. Open since 1998, we have a large selection of history, literature, philosophy, art, music, religion, science, and technical books. Thanks for visiting our profile!
